Our primary goal is to keep you informed of what we offer and how your student can take advantage of services.
- One-on-one career advising to develop career goals, assess interest and abilities for possible career applications. Additionally, each student is given a career advisor to enhance the advising process through the four-year Career Advisor Program.
- Assessment testing with any of the four free instruments to assist students in making informed career choices, (Holland Self-Directed Search, Myers-Briggs Type Indicator, Strong Interest Inventory, and Focus II).
- E-mail notifications about jobs, internships, summer opportunities, and updates on career events through Monday Message and posted at www.collegecentral.com/marietta under Announcements.
- On campus recruiting from nationally recognized employers seeking full-time and intern candidates and graduate schools.
- Job fairs in several parts of the state and country to expose students to career opportunities nationwide.
- Use of Mentoring Network, a database of alumni searchable by location, employer or career field available at College Central.
- Use of the Career Center 24/7 through College Central Network, Inc. Search for internships, summer jobs and full/part-time positions online.
